Personal data Symon Dickinson 

Source 1
  • He was born on June 24, 1541 in Bradley Hall, Staffordshire, England.
  • He died in the year 1613 in Bradley Hall, Staffordshire, England, he was 71 years old.
  • A child of Richard Dickinson. and Elizabeth Bagnell.

Household of Symon Dickinson

He is married to Catherine Sutton.

They got married about 1564 at Bradley, Staffordshire, England.

They got married on February 21, 1584 at 1675922, Staffordshire, England, he was 42 years old.
